Frank witnessed a burglary, and he felt very upset. Shortly after the event, Frank lost his ability to see. Doctors were unable to find a biological reason for his blindness. Which of the following is Frank most likely experiencing? a. Panic disorderb. Bipolar disorderc. Conversion disorderd. Tardive diskenesiae. Schizophrenia

    Frank is most likely experiencing C. Conversion disorder.

    Explanation:

    Conversion disorder occurs when an individual suffers some type of neurologic symptom such as blindness or paralysis that cannot be explained from a physiological perspective.

    Its main cause is a psychological trauma or conflict, such as witnessing something particularly distressing. This condition is not faked for personal gain; the individual generally feels these symptoms and they are involuntary.

    In this case, Frank the burglary witnessing was very distressful for Frank and his mind could not handel it as such, causing the conversion disorder.
